What companies run services between Horley, Surrey, England and Cranleigh, Surrey, England?

There is no direct connection from Horley to Cranleigh. However, you can take the train to Redhill, take the train to Shalford (Surrey), walk to Shalford station, then take the line 53 bus to New Park Road. Alternatively, you can take a train from Horley to Hitherwood via Horsham, Railway Station, and Bus Station in around 2h 18m.
